> Janne,
>
> You've encountered a bug that shows when wee_import is run under python 2 
> using a user defined field map. The fix required was not to wee_import 
> but elsewhere in WeeWX and will appear in the next release (expected to be 
> 4.6.3). In the meantime since you are using WeeWX v4.6.2 you can safely 
> just download the patched file, replace the corresponding file on your 
> system and wee_import should work fine. To download and install the 
> patched file:
>
> 1. move aside the file to be patched:
> $ mv /usr/share/weewx/weeutil/weeutil.py 
> /usr/share/weewx/weeutil/weeutil_orig.py
>
> 2. download the patched file:
> $ wget -P /usr/share/weewx/weeutil/ 
> https://raw.githubusercontent.com/weewx/weewx/master/bin/weeutil/weeutil.py
>
> 3. stop WeeWX (if it is running) and perform your import
>
> I did a test import using the patched file, your import config file and 
> your CSV data. The raw_datetime_format setting in your import config file 
> needs to be changed to match the format of the date-time field your are 
> using in your source data, it needs to be set as follows:
>
> raw_datetime_format = "%d.%m.%y %H:%M"
>
> With this change your data imported correctly and with out error. Note 
> that you will likely receive the following message during the import:
>
> Warning: Import field 'gustDir' is mapped to WeeWX field 'windGustDir' but 
> the
>  import field 'gustDir' could not be found in one or more records.
>  WeeWX field 'windGustDir' will be set to 'None' in these records.
>
> This is just a warning that you have a mapped field for which there is no 
> source data. It can be safely ignored. 
>
> Gary

[weewx-user] 4.6.2. update problem with wee_import

2022-02-20 Thread jannep...@gmail.com
Hi, I updated from 4.5 to 4.6.2 and my wee_import stop to next message:

I use WS6in1-driver with my Ventus.

...
Using WeeWX configuration file /etc/weewx/weewx.conf
Starting wee_import...
A CSV import from source file '/var/tmp/data.csv' has been requested.
Using database binding 'wx_binding', which is bound to database 'weewx.sdb'
Destination table 'archive' unit system is '0x11' (METRICWX).
Missing derived observations will be calculated.
This is a dry run, imported data will not be saved to archive.
Starting dry run import ...
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/share/weewx/wee_import", line 899, in 
main()
  File "/usr/share/weewx/wee_import", line 829, in main
source_obj.run()
  File "/usr/share/weewx/weeimport/weeimport.py", line 372, in run
_raw_data = self.getRawData(period)
  File "/usr/share/weewx/weeimport/csvimport.py", line 246, in getRawData
self.map = self.parseMap('CSV', _csv_reader, self.csv_config_dict)
  File "/usr/share/weewx/weeimport/weeimport.py", line 635, in parseMap
and _val['units'] not in weewx.units.USUnits.values():
AttributeError: 'ListOfDicts' object has no attribute 'values'
..

What this does mean? Any help? 

Is there easy way to get back to working configuration (4.5)?
